## Further reading

If you're reviewing changes to the Coppermere reconciliation job, it helps to understand the three-way match it performs between warehouse scans, the order ledger, and the carrier feed. Discrepancies are scored and bucketed before any write-back occurs, and the tolerance thresholds are deliberately conservative. The design rationale, edge cases, and historical incident notes are collected on the internal page here.

wiki page, bagef-yahag: https://confluence.lumiclabs.internal/projects/browse/browse/projects/1a81

Subject: DR Drill — Autocomplete Index Slowness (Thistledown)

Hi all — welcome aboard. During Thursday's disaster-recovery drill, the Thistledown autocomplete index rebuilt slower than expected, roughly forty minutes. We'll rerun with warm caches next week. New team members should watch the index lag dashboard during the drill. To access the drill's recovery console and follow along, use the passphrase provided below.

unlock words, kagef-taduf: fenir-quenix-norwyn-sorvan-gormir-gorir-fraok

## Deploying the Gatewick Proctor Queue

Deploys are pretty painless: push to main, wait for the pipeline, then watch the queue drain dashboard for five minutes. If candidates pile up mid-exam, roll back first and ask questions later — the queue replays safely. Everything the workers care about lives in one config block, shown here for reference.

settings of bafof-yagef:
JOROX_PIN=8740
JOROX_TENANT=pelox
JOROX_METRICS_HOST=metrics.jorox.qorvelworks.internal
JOROX_SEAL=seal_c78f63c1
JOROX_STANDBY_TEAM=norax

Subject: DR Drill — SquatSift Scanner Restore

Team,

Next Tuesday's disaster-recovery drill covers SquatSift, our typo-squatting package scanner. We'll rebuild the scanner from the cold backup, replay the last registry diff, and verify the fuzzy-match ruleset loads cleanly. Future maintainers should note that the rules bundle is encrypted at rest and won't decrypt without operator input. When prompted during the restore, enter the recovery passphrase shown below.

unlock words, tawif-tahop: oliys-ulawyn-tamdor-lamys-casox-jormir-fraius-kasath-ulador-ulamir-holir-sorys-holeth